Compare all specifications:
1963 Isuzu Bellett | 1978 Vauxhall Cavalier | |
Make | Isuzu | Vauxhall |
Model | Bellett | Cavalier |
Year Released | 1963 | 1978 |
Body Type | Coupe | Coupe |
Engine Position | Front | Front |
Engine Size | 1818 cc | 1256 cc |
Engine Cylinders | 4 cylinders | 4 cylinders |
Engine Type | in-line | in-line |
Horse Power | 100 HP | 0 HP |
Drive Type | Rear | Rear |
Transmission Type | Manual | Manual |
Vehicle Weight | 945 kg | 895 kg |
Vehicle Length | 4020 mm | 4460 mm |
Vehicle Width | 1500 mm | 1680 mm |
Vehicle Height | 1340 mm | 1290 mm |
Wheelbase Size | 2360 mm | 2530 mm |
